Southern California Pizza Co.
Organized by Sentinel and management in 2008, Southern California Pizza owned and operated Pizza Hut restaurants in the greater Los Angeles market and had the rights to develop the Pizza Hut brand in the region. Sentinel helped Southern California Pizza transform from a group of 123 stores tightly integrated into Pizza Hut’s infrastructure into a standalone business with its own management and corporate infrastructure. In 2009, Southern California Pizza bought another 98 Pizza Huts in northern Los Angeles, making it the largest franchisee in California and the third-largest in the Pizza Hut system.
In 2012, after achieving substantially all of Sentinel’s investment objectives, Southern California Pizza was sold to another private equity firm.
